About Ne-Yo: The Architect of Modern R&B
Shaffer Chimere Smith, known to the world as Ne-Yo, is far more than just a singer; he's a true musical alchemist. His journey to fame is a testament to his multifaceted talent, initially carving out a name for himself as a prolific songwriter penning hits for the likes of Mario ("Let Me Love You"). It was in 2006, however, that Ne-Yo truly stepped into the spotlight with the release of his debut album, In My Own Words. This seminal record, featuring the chart-topping single "So Sick," catapulted him to superstardom, solidifying his reputation as a formidable voice in contemporary R&B.
Ne-Yo's musical style is characterized by its sophisticated blend of classic soul, contemporary R&B, and pop sensibilities, often infused with a smooth, velvety vocal delivery and insightful, relatable lyrics. Over the years, he has masterfully evolved, experimenting with different sonic palettes while always maintaining his signature melodic prowess and emotional depth. Albums like Because of You (2007) and Libra Scale (2010) showcased his artistic growth, earning him critical acclaim and a legion of devoted fans. His achievements are numerous, including multiple Grammy Awards, Soul Train Awards, and BET Awards, alongside a successful career as a producer and actor. Shoreline Amphitheatre: The Perfect Setting for a Soulful Evening
Nestled on the southern shores of San Francisco Bay, the Shoreline Amphitheatre in Mountain View is a venue that perfectly complements the smooth sounds of Ne-Yo. Opened in 1985, this sprawling outdoor arena has hosted some of music's most iconic performers, becoming a beloved landmark for Bay Area music lovers. With a substantial capacity that can swell to over 22,000, including lawn seating, it offers an intimate yet grand atmosphere, ideal for a large-scale R&B concert.
The venue's unique architectural design, featuring a sweeping roof that provides some shelter and directs sound, coupled with its expansive open-air setting, creates a vibrant and engaging concert experience. Getting to Shoreline Amphitheatre: Your Ultimate Transport Guide
Navigating your way to the Shoreline Amphitheatre in Mountain View is a breeze with a little planning. For those travelling via public transport, the nearest Caltrain station is Mountain View Station, which serves the Peninsula Corridor line. From the station, it's approximately a 30-40 minute walk to the venue, or you can opt for a short taxi or rideshare. Unfortunately, there are no direct metro or tube lines serving the immediate vicinity of Shoreline Amphitheatre, making Caltrain the most viable rail option.
Bus services are available, with VTA (Valley Transportation Authority) bus routes serving the Mountain View Transit Center, which is also a short walk from the station. Routes like the 523 and 22 may provide connections depending on your starting point, but it’s essential to check the VTA schedule closer to the date for the most accurate information. If you’re driving, Shoreline Amphitheatre has on-site parking, but be warned: it can be limited and quite expensive, especially for major events. Arriving early is highly recommended if you plan to drive, ideally at least 1.5 to 2 hours before doors open to secure a parking spot and avoid significant traffic delays. For those staying nearby, walking might be an option if you're in the immediate Shoreline West or Shoreline North neighbourhoods, but always assess the distance and ensure you have comfortable footwear. Considering the potential parking challenges and traffic, arriving by public transport like Caltrain and then walking or taking a short ride is often the most stress-free approach. Disabled access is available, with designated parking and seating areas; contact the venue directly for specific arrangements and transport assistance.
